Profile

Andrew Boesenecker is an American politician, pastor, and former educator serving as a member of the Colorado House of Representatives for the 53rd district. Since assuming office in 2021, he has focused his legislative platform on affordable housing, reproductive and behavioral healthcare access, and support for small businesses and workers. In 2025, he was appointed to serve as the Speaker pro Tem of the Colorado House. Prior to his political career, Boesenecker worked as a music teacher and a Lutheran pastor, and he has held a leadership role in the Semester at Sea program.
